Investigation revealed the following:

Allegation: Facility staff are not properly addressing pests in the facility
It is alleged that the facility has unsanitary conditions, specifically that the floors are covered with cockroaches as reported by R1.

On 07/28/2026 between 10:00AM and 04:45 PM the department interviewed the Administrator Coty Cabral Staff #1 (S1). During the interview the department asked S1 whether the facility attempts to eliminate roaches, S1 stated that Dewey Pest Control provides services twice a week each month, and staff will occasionally use Raid if needed. S1 also reported that she has not personally seen any roaches at the facility. On 07/28/26 the department conducted interviews with Staff#1-#3 (S1-S3) and Residents#1, #2, #3. An attempt was made to interview Residents #4 and #5 (R4-R5) but R4 refused to be interviewed and R5 was non-verbal and could not respond to the questions at the time of visit. Out of those Staff interviewed 3 out of 3 denied the above allegation. Out of those Residents interviewed 2 out of 3 denied the above allegation. On 07/28/26 the department obtained and reviewed the Service Inspection Reports from (Dewey Pest Control) dated 04/21/26, 06/15/26 and it showed that extermination services were conducted for ants, crickets, roaches, silverfish and spiders. The department also observed that the facility was clean and in good repair and did not observe any pests at the time of visit.
Based on the information gathered, interviews conducted, and an analysis of records reviewed, the Department found no evidence to support the allegation mentioned above. Although the allegation may have happened or is valid, there is not a preponderance of evidence to prove the alleged violation, did or did not occur, therefore the allegation is Unsubstantiated.
